Mia’s offers a stunning variety of cupcakes, each priced at 4.62, featuring classics like Vanilla, Chocolate, and Red Velvet, alongside creative options such as Nutella and Salted Caramel. For those looking to indulge in something more unique, the special cupcake priced at 4.91, is a must-try.

  • Cupcake Collection: The diverse lineup caters to all tastes, making it difficult to choose just one!
  • Cookies Galore: Don’t miss out on their cookies, all priced at 4.97, with highlights including the mouthwatering Chocolate Chip and the classic Peanut Butter.
  • Tempting Tarts: Their tarts, starting at 9.07, offer a perfect balance of flavors, with fruity options like the Lemon Raspberry and traditional favorites like Apple Crumble.

My partner and I ordered a slice of blackout cake to go - TASTE: 4/5 - this classic chocolate cake really hit the spot and wasn't too artificially sweet TEXTURE: 5/5 - blackout cake sounds heavy, but it was honestly well balanced w moist cake, light chocolate custard, and chocolate cake crumbs PRICE: 4/5 - the individual slice isn't cheap. Total came to $9 SERVING SIZE: 4/5 - we shared this post-dinner slice and it was enough to satisfy our craving SERVICE: 4/5 - walked in at 6pm on a Saturday and only a couple others were inside. Staff was friendly ATMOSPHERE: 4/5 - we'd been waiting in anticipation for this Mia's Brooklyn Bakery location to open up lol. A bright, cozy spot though no chairs or tables to dine in TAKEOUT: 4/5 - was impressed that the cake slice came in a small box lol PARKING: 5/5 - plenty of parking in the Derby St parking lot
